2. Flipkart

Flipkart is the largest e-commerce marketplace in India with an extensive catalog of products including fashion, electronics, and other grocery items. Flipkart also offers an easy return policy.

The company has a huge logistics network and a monopoly on its supply chain, giving it an edge over competitors who outsource their shipping. It offers a variety of products at affordable prices and frequently offers discounts to customers.

Its fashion-focused platform, Myntra, caters to fashion-conscious customers, while its mobile app and financial and payment service company known as PhonePe have helped Flipkart expand its reach beyond India's larger cities.

In 2020, the company plans to purchase a stake in Walmart's Best Price cash and carry business to enhance its wholesale offerings. Flipkart plans to expand its presence into rural markets in the future. The company is valued at $24.9 billion.

6. Taobao

The e-commerce platform is operated by Alibaba Group. Its strong infrastructure with user-generated reviews, as well as a deep understanding of the local market enable Taobao to draw loyal customers. It has a wide range of products that will help shoppers find what they're looking for.

The site is designed to appeal to a mobile-first user base with a simple navigation system, personalized recommendations, and social features such as instant messaging. It also has a highly effective dispute resolution system that builds trust between buyers and sellers. In addition the integration with Alipay lets users make secure payments. The extensive range of products and competitive pricing gives the site an edge over other platforms. It has grown to become China's top C2C platform. With its expanding global reach, the website is set to become a major player in international e-commerce.

9. LUISAVIAROMA

LUISAVIAROMA has perfected the art of dominating the e-commerce luxury market. What started as a tiny shop selling hats on Via Roma, Florence in the 19th century, today has over 600 brands on its shelves and attracts millions of shoppers every month.

You can find designer clothing, shoes, and bags for women, men and children as well as beauty products, home furnishings and accessories. The carefully curated collection also includes various options that are sustainable like Veja sneakers and Stella McCartney dress.
